Handover note for review: Lorica ORM refactor

I've split the legacy Lorica data layer into a thin mapper and an explicit query builder; the old active-record calls are shimmed behind adapters so callers migrate incrementally. Please review the transaction boundary changes first — they're the riskiest part. Migration scripts are staged but not run; the schema snapshot used for regression diffs lives in the sealed fixtures archive on the Varnholt share. Opening that archive requires the fixtures recovery passphrase, recorded on the line below.

strongbox words: fenwyn-tamys-norys-lamius-gilion-gilath

## Further Reading

The Greywharf warehouse partitions its fact tables by calendar month, and most query performance questions trace back to partition pruning. Before modifying any schema, read the partitioning design notes: they explain retention windows, the monthly rollover job, and why cross-month queries need explicit date bounds. The full internal design document is maintained on the page below.

wiki page, tahaf-tajog: https://jira.ordindyn.corp/pipeline

## Changelog — Furrowlink gateway 5.1: default changes

For those new to the team: the telemetry gateway previously buffered tractor and harvester readings for up to six hours before flushing, which hid connectivity problems on remote farms. As of 5.1, the default flush interval drops to fifteen minutes, compression is enabled out of the box, and stale readings older than 48 hours are discarded rather than forwarded. Upgraded gateways adopt these defaults unless overridden. The new defaults are listed below.

settings of kajep-kajop:
OLIDOR_LOG_LEVEL=info
OLIDOR_METRICS_HOST=metrics.olidor.norvacorp.corp
OLIDOR_POOL_SIZE=4